Tom Welling: The Man Behind the Cape

From Model to Clark Kent

Tom Welling, born on April 7, 1977, in Putnam Valley, New York, started his career as a model. However, it was his audition for a certain Kansas farm boy that would change his life forever. In 2001, Welling was cast as Clark Kent in the WB (now The CW) series Smallville, a role that would catapult him to fame and keep him busy for a decade.

Smallville's Clark Kent

Smallville was a unique take on the Superman story, focusing on the early years of the Man of Steel before he donned the iconic cape. Welling's Clark Kent was a relatable, charming, and often vulnerable young man, struggling with his powers and the weight of his destiny. Through his portrayal, Welling made audiences care for Clark, root for him, and ultimately fall in love with the character.

Welling's performance was marked by his ability to balance Clark's humanity with his otherworldly powers. He brought a quiet strength and an unassuming charm to the role, making it easy for viewers to see why everyone from Lana Lang to Lois Lane fell for the farm boy from Smallville.

Brandon Routh: The Man of Steel Takes Flight

From Broadway to Superman

Brandon Routh, born on October 9, 1979, in Des Moines, Iowa, had an impressive Broadway resume before making his mark on the silver screen. In 2006, Routh stepped into the iconic red boots and blue tights to play Superman in Bryan Singer's Superman Returns.

Superman Returns

Routh's Superman was a more hopeful and optimistic take on the character, harking back to the classic films of the 40s and 50s. He brought a sense of wonder and awe to the role, capturing the essence of the Man of Steel's unyielding optimism and determination.

Routh's performance was a love letter to the classic Superman, paying homage to the character's history while also bringing something fresh and new to the role. His Superman was a beacon of hope, a symbol of truth and justice, and a hero that audiences could believe in.
